I’m having a problem trying to get the value of the ID item that has been clicked in an asp.net Repeater. My Repeater has an image that opens a dialog, and from that dialog opened, when I click Approve, I would like to get this value in the .cs file when I’m redirected because the ApproveChange_Click event. I’m not doing any DataBinder.Eval to the Id I want to retrieve in the Repeater. How can I accomplish that? If I use session variables, where I can set up the value in the .aspx page and how. Thanks in advance!

This is the Repeater:

<tr class="<%# Container.ItemIndex % 2 != 0 ? "" : "odd" %>">
     <td class ="approval-img"><a class ="approvalDialog" href='#'><img src="/Images/Approve.png" alt ="Approve"/></td></a>
     <td class ="approval-img"><a class ="declineDialog" href='#'><img src="/Images/Decline.png" alt ="Decline"/></td></a>
     ...
</tr>

And this the dialog:

<div id="approval-form" style="display: none; cursor: default">
    <div class="approve-change">
        <ul>
        <li>
            <p><label>Reason</label></p>
            <textarea id="txtReason" runat="server" cols="1" rows="1" class="required"></textarea><br />
        </li>
        <li>
            <span>
            <asp:Button ID="btnApprove" runat="server" CssClass="blue" Text="Approve" ToolTip = "Approve" OnClick="ApproveChange_Click" />
            <button id="btnCancelApprove" class="blue">Cancel</button>
            </span>
        </li>
        </ul>
    </div>
</div>

    Here is the solution that I have found:
    First: change the tag in the repeater for ImageButton, for have the chance to send a command argument to the event

    <td class ="approval-img"><asp:ImageButton runat="server" CommandArgument = '<%# Eval("aux_approvalId")%>'  OnClick="getApprovalID_approve" ToolTip="Approve" ImageUrl="/Images/Approve.png" /></td>
    

    So, when I’m redirected to OnClick event, with this, I get the ID and after the dialog is opened.

    ImageButton btn = (ImageButton)(sender);
    Session["ApprovalID"] = btn.CommandArgument;
    string script = "OpenApprovalDialog();";
    Page.ClientScript.RegisterStartupScript(typeof(Page), "", script, true);
